> I use flexbackup to backup my notebook which I move between work and > home. I want to be able to backup to different devices depeding on where > I am. Reason is that at work I backup to a network disc which is not > mapped when I'm at home. I guess I can get it to work by having two > alternative conf files but I'd much rather have a "device" flag which > would override the default choice. Any thoughts on this? It's already there: flexbackup -device <whatever> ... will override the config file setting. -- Edwin Huffstutler [EMAIL PROTECTED] GnuPG Key ID: AE782DC9 ------------------------------------------------------- This SF.net email is sponsored by: The SF.net Donation Program.
